ホームページ > システムチュートリアル > Windowsシリーズ > Windows11ホストファイルを最適な制御のために変更する効果的な方法

Windows11ホストファイルを最適な制御のために変更する効果的な方法

尊渡假赌尊渡假赌尊渡假赌
リリース: 2025-03-11 11:13:17
オリジナル
446 人が閲覧しました

最適な制御のためにWindows 11ホストファイルを変更する効果的な方法

Windows 11ホストファイルを変更すると、ドメイン名を特定のIPアドレスにマッピングすることにより、ネットワークトラフィックの粒状制御が可能になります。これは、悪意のあるWebサイトのブロック、ローカル開発環境のテスト、または特定のドメインのDNS解像度をバイパスすることにより、ネットワークパフォーマンスの改善に役立ちます。ただし、誤った変更により接続の問題が発生する可能性があるため、慎重な編集が重要です。 2つの主要な方法があります。ノートパッド(または同様のテキストエディター)の使用とPowerShellの使用。このファイルを編集するには、管理者の権限が必要です。これは、許可エラーを防ぐために重要です。

  • ファイルを編集します:ホストファイルは簡単な形式を使用します: IPアドレスHOSTNAME 。各行はマッピングを表します。新しいエントリを追加するには、IPアドレスとホスト名で新しい行を追加するだけです。たとえば、 www.example.com をブロックするには、 127.0.0.1 www.example.com を追加する場合があります。エントリを削除するには、対応する行を削除します。
  • ファイルを保存:変更を行ったら、ファイルを保存します。変更を保存するには、管理者の特権が必要になる場合があることに注意してください。
  • PowerShell:

    PowerShellは、自動化やスクリプティングに最適なよりプログラム的なアプローチを提供します。 set-content cmdletを使用して、ホストファイルを変更できます。たとえば、次のコマンドはエントリ 192.168.1.100 mylocalsite.com

     <code class="powershell"> set -content -path&quot; c:\ windows \ system32 \ drivers \ etc \ hosts&quot; -value&quot; 192.168.1.100 mylocalsite.com&quot; -ASCII -Force </code> 
    ログイン後にコピー

    -Encoding ascii パラメーターは、ファイルが正しい形式で保存され、 -force が既存のファイルを上書きします。この方法では、正しく使用されない場合、潜在的なデータ損失を慎重に検討する必要があります。 PowerShellを使用して大幅な変更を加える前に、常に元のファイルをバックアップしてください。複数のエントリの追加や既存のエントリの操作など、より複雑な操作には、より高度なPowerShellスクリプトが必要です。

    システムエラーを引き起こすことなくWindows 11ホストファイルを簡単に編集するにはどうすればよいですか?ベストプラクティスの内訳は次のとおりです。
    1. 常に元のファイルをバックアップします:変更を加える前に、 hosts ファイルのコピーを作成します。これにより、問題が発生した場合、元の構成に簡単に戻すことができます。ハードドライブの別の場所にファイルをコピーするだけです。
    2. 管理者の特権を持つテキストエディターを使用します。そうしないと、許可エラーが発生し、変更の保存が妨げられます。
    3. ファイル形式を理解します。各行は単一のマッピングを表します。スペースは非常に重要です。 IPアドレスとホスト名の間にスペースが1つしかないことを確認してください。誤ったフォーマットはエラーにつながる可能性があります。
    4. エントリをダブルチェックする:変更を保存する前に、各エントリを慎重に確認して正確性を確保します。単一のタイプミスは接続の問題を引き起こす可能性があります。
    5. 変更を徐々にテストします。複数の変更を一度に変更する代わりに、ホストファイルを段階的に変更し、各変更の効果を個別にテストします。これは、発生する問題を分離するのに役立ちます。
    6. システムの再起動(オプション):常に必要ではありませんが、システムへの変更を再起動すると、ファイルへの変更が完全に有効になります。誤ったIPアドレスは、意図したWebサイトをブロックしないか、他のサイトを不注意にブロックする場合があります。フィッシングドメイン。これにより、ブラウザがこれらのサイトに接続できなくなります。マルウェアブラックリストなどの評判の良いソースを使用して、悪意のあるドメインのリストを定期的に更新します。
    7. ブロックフィッシングサイト:同様に、資格盗難を防ぐために既知のフィッシングWebサイトをブロックします。繰り返しますが、信頼できるソースからの更新リストに頼ってください。
    8. ブロック不要な広告とトラッカー:ホストファイルを使用して多くの広告ネットワークと追跡サービスをブロックできます。広告やトラッカーをブロックするように特別に設計された多数の公開されているホストファイルは、オンラインで簡単に入手できます。ただし、注意を払って、評判の良いソースからファイルのみをダウンロードします。
    9. ホストファイルを定期的に更新してください:悪意のあるWebサイトとフィッシングドメインは絶えず進化しています。したがって、その有効性を維持するために、信頼できるソースからの最新情報をホストファイルを定期的に更新します。
    10. ホストファイルのみに依存しないでください。堅牢なセキュリティ戦略には、ファイアウォール、ウイルス対策ソフトウェア、安全な閲覧習慣などの多層的なアプローチが必要です。最適化:
      1. ローカル開発環境のテスト:ローカルWebサーバーまたはアプリケーションのIPアドレスにカスタムドメイン名をマップします。これにより、DNS設定を構成する必要なく開発作業をテストできます。これにより、DNS解像度プロセスが回転し、特に遅いまたは信頼性の低いDNSサーバーを備えた環境で、Webサイトの読み込み時間を高速化する可能性があります。ただし、これには、定期的に変更される可能性のあるターゲットドメインのIPアドレスを知る必要があります。
      2. ネットワーク接続の問題の問題:
      特定のドメインがネットワークの問題を引き起こしていると疑っている場合、問題を分離するためにホストファイルを使用して一時的にブロックできます。たとえば、 127.0.0.1 *.example.com は、 example.com のすべてのサブドメインをブロックします。これは、広範な結果をもたらす可能性があるため、慎重に使用してください。これは、ブロックされたドメインの大規模なリストを管理したり、テスト環境の構成を自動化するのに特に役立ちます。

    高度な手法では、ネットワーキングの概念と潜在的な結果を完全に理解する必要があることを忘れないでください。不正確な使用は、ネットワークの不安定性につながる可能性があります。重要な変更を加える前に、常にホストファイルをバックアップしてください。

    以上がWindows11ホストファイルを最適な制御のために変更する効果的な方法の詳細内容です。詳細については、PHP 中国語 Web サイトの他の関連記事を参照してください。

    このウェブサイトの声明
    この記事の内容はネチズンが自主的に寄稿したものであり、著作権は原著者に帰属します。このサイトは、それに相当する法的責任を負いません。盗作または侵害の疑いのあるコンテンツを見つけた場合は、admin@php.cn までご連絡ください。
    人気のチュートリアル
    詳細>
    最新のダウンロード
    詳細>
    ウェブエフェクト
    公式サイト
    サイト素材
    フロントエンドテンプレート